Jose Enrique has urged his old side Newcastle to elbow Tottenham side and land Christian Eriksen on a free transfer from Brentford in the summer. Eriksen is available on a free and both Newcastle and Spurs are interested.

Eriksen, 30, has returned from near death during Euro 2020 when he collapsed in Copenhagen – to return and shine in the Premier League. He scored in a 4-1 win at Chelsea for Brentford, his first goal since the incident.

90Min report that West Ham, Newcastle and Tottenham are all interested in signing Eriksen this summer – with the Dane proving he is back to his best, but available on a free. Brentford handed him a contract until the summer.

It might be that Eriksen feels he has a debt to pay Brentford in offering him a way back in, but the lure of a bigger Premier League club is also tempting. Enrique has urged Eriksen to pick Newcastle, over Spurs and West Ham.

Where next for Eriksen – Brentford, Newcastle, West Ham or Spurs?

A reunion not only with Tottenham, but also Antonio Conte – the duo combined to win Serie A with Inter – would be stunning. Conte got the best out of Eriksen and so did Tottenham. Does he fit in now? Time will tell.

At Newcastle, Eriksen would be a solid addition but he would prefer to play in a side in Europe – or at least pushing for it. West Ham are one of Tottenham’s rivals. It is unlikely he would put his Spurs allegiance aside.

So, it seems as if Eriksen has two choices. Stay at Brentford and show loyalty to the side that gave him a chance and a route back in – or set up a stunning return to Spurs.
